Demand for groundfish data continues to increase

September 6, 2017 — The Sentinel Survey, now in its eighth year of research, collects data on the status of groundfish populations in Eastern Maine. The survey is conducted by Maine Center for Coastal Fisheries, in collaboration with the University of Maine. Fishermen visit a total of 84 survey stations from June to October, along with researchers who study the population, distribution, and most important, the genetic makeup of groundfish in each location, according to a news release from MCCF.

The Sentinel Survey has become the leading source of information on groundfish in Eastern Maine, the release states. The unique summer sampling season and localized-scale produces heavily sought after data. The survey design also uses a combination of gear types, longline and jig hooks, to sample areas where larger, more traditional trawling methods struggle—areas with rocky bottoms and an abundance of lobster traps. Since 2010, Maine Center for Coastal Fisheries has collected data on more than 20 groundfish species, most notably cod, halibut, mackerel, cusk, haddock, pollock and hake.

Increasingly, scientists are requesting access to survey samples of stomach content, heart, otolith (or ear bone), fin clip, gonad, and muscle tissue, as they seek to understand the status of depleted groundfish populations. According to lead researcher on the Sentinel Survey, Mattie Rodrigue, “data from even a single fish is crucial. Biological analysis can unlock a picture of where that species has been, the distinct sub-populations it’s related to, what it’s been eating, its reproductive patterns, and more.”

Maine Center for Coastal Fisheries has led a collaborative effort to distribute Sentinel Survey data to organizations up and down the coast, from Massachusetts to Canada. Scientists want access to specific data, and the survey can provide that information. Institutions, including the University of Maine, the University of New Hampshire, Gulf of Maine Research Institute, Woods Hole Oceanographic Institute, the Massachusetts Division of Marine Fisheries, and Fisheries and Oceans Canada, rely on the survey.

Climate Change May Shrink the World’s Fish

A new study suggests warming sea temperatures could result in smaller fish sizes.

August 22, 2017 — Warming temperatures and loss of oxygen in the sea will shrink hundreds of fish species—from tunas and groupers to salmon, thresher sharks, haddock and cod—even more than previously thought, a new study concludes.

Because warmer seas speed up their metabolisms, fish, squid and other water-breathing creatures will need to draw more oxygen from the ocean. At the same time, warming seas are already reducing the availability of oxygen in many parts of the sea.

A pair of University of British Columbia scientists argue that since the bodies of fish grow faster than their gills, these animals eventually will reach a point where they can’t get enough oxygen to sustain normal growth.

“What we found was that the body size of fish decreases by 20 to 30 percent for every 1 degree Celsius increase in water temperature,” says author William Cheung, director of science for the university’s Nippon Foundation—Nereus Program.

These changes, the scientists say, will have a profound impact on many marine food webs, upending predator-prey relationships in ways that are hard to predict.

“Lab experiments have shown that it’s always the large species that will become stressed first,” says lead author Daniel Pauly, a professor at the university’s Institute for the Ocean and Fisheries, and principal investigator for the Sea Around Us. “Small species have an advantage, respiration-wise.”

Still, while many scientists applaud the discovery, not all agree that Pauly’s and Cheung’s work supports their dramatic findings. The study was published today in the journal Global Change Biology.

NOAA Endorses Eating Small Haddock — But What About Cod?

August 17, 2017 — SEAFOOD NEWS — The National Oceanic and Atmospheric Administration (NOAA) are giving their stamp of approval to eat small haddock.

In the July issue of the NOAA Fisheries Navigator, the government agency reports that smaller haddock does not necessarily mean an unhealthy stock. Looking at stats dating back to 1995, the size of the fish has been decreasing — but the population has been growing.

This trend is something that the organization has seen in the past. “A decline in the average size of Georges Bank haddock also happened in the mid-1960s when a larger number of haddock were born in 1963 and grew into the population,” the report reads. And according to their research, the size of the stock is large simply because the fish are “generally able to spawn before being harvested.” Data collected from Georges Bank haddock in 2015 revealed that 90% of the fish mature at age three. Commercial minimum size is 16 inches, which is generally a two to five year old fish. That means that most fish are able to spawn once or twice before being caught.

But the endorsement from NOAA still comes as a surprise to some. As Navigator magazine editor Kerry Hann notes in the September 2017 issue, the thumbs up to eat small haddock is a “somewhat peculiar statement from the U.S.-based organization tasked with providing science-based conservation and management for sustainable fisheries and aquaculture, marine mammals, endangered species and their habitats.”

For Hann, it all goes back to 1992 when the cod industry was faced with a similar situation.

“Fewer larger, spawning-aged fish were being caught, leaving the dwindling cod populations made up of primarily small, juvenile fish,” Hann writes. “Many at the time concluded that a healthy cod population could not be made up of only small fish.”

So, what about cod today? That’s an upcoming discussion for “Cod — Building the Fishery of the Future,” a conference being held by the Canadian Centre for Fisheries Innovation in November.

NOAA Fisheries Announces Catch Limits for 4 Groundfish Stocks and Windowpane Flounder Accountability Measures in Framework 56

August 1, 2017 — The following was released by NOAA Fisheries:

Today, NOAA Fisheries announces the implementation of Framework 56 to the Northeast Multispecies Fishery Management Plan.

Framework 56 sets catch limits for four groundfish stocks for the 2017 fishing year (through April 30, 2018). The changes in these catch limits relative to fishing year 2016 are as follows:

  • Georges Bank cod quota will decrease by 13%;
  • Georges Bank haddock quota will increase by 2%;
  • Georges Bank yellowtail flounder will decrease 23%; and
  • Witch flounder quota will increase 91%.

We set catch limits for the 2017 fishing year for the remaining 16 groundfish stocks last year in Framework 55. The 2017 catch limits for these 16 stocks remain the same as or similar to 2016 limits.

The action sets sector allocations and common pool trip limits based on the 2017 limits and finalized 2017 sector rosters.

Framework 56 also:

  • Creates an allocation of northern windowpane flounder for the scallop fishery;
  • Revises the trigger for implementing the scallop fishery’s accountability measures for both its GB yellowtail flounder and northern windowpane flounder allocation; and
  • Increases the GB haddock allocation for the midwater trawl fishery.

Finally, this action implements the accountability measures for the 2017 fishing year for the northern and southern windowpane flounder.

NOAA Fisheries Announces 2017 Recreational Measures for Gulf of Maine Cod and Haddock

July 27, 2017 — The following was released by NOAA Fisheries:

NOAA Fisheries announces recreational measures for Gulf of Maine cod and haddock for the remainder of the 2017 fishing year.

These measures are effective immediately.

Gulf of Maine Cod:

No Possession

Gulf of Maine Haddock:

Minimum size: 17 inches

Daily limit: 12 fish per angler per day

Open Seasons: May 1-September 16; November 1-February 28; April 15-30

HILDE LEE: Cod has special place in nation’s food history

July 11, 2017 — I have a certain curiosity about food, particularly seafood. I am not shy about asking, “Is the fish fresh? When did it come in?”

Thus, one day I got the definitive answer from one a man at one of our local grocery store fish counters. “Yes, the fish is fresh and we get it frozen. I only thaw out what I think will sell daily. Thus, the fish is very fresh.” Well, it may be fresh, but it was frozen. After all, we are not on the seacoast.

I like cod and the various members of the cod family — haddock, hake, pollock and Atlantic cod. The flesh of these fish is usually firm, making it ideal for a variety of dishes — broiled, baked, and stewed. Cod is also a good receiver of sauces, particularly tomato-based ones with herbs.

Just like the bison and the eagle, cod can be considered a symbol of America. It was here even before the first settlers came to New England, where cod was plentiful.

When Giovanni Caboto sailed from Bristol, England, on May 2, 1497, he, like Columbus, was searching for a western sea route to Asia. But Caboto — known as John Cabot, a Venetian navigator sponsored by King Henry VII — returned from his first voyage not with exotic spices, but tales of the sea. He told of the many fishes that could be caught simply by lowering weighted baskets into the water.

Even before Cabot’s reports of great schools of cod along the northern shores of the new continent, fishermen from Scandinavian areas had spent any years fishing the North Atlantic.

By 1602, Bartholomew Gosnold ventured south beyond Nova Scotia seeking sassafras — believed to be a cure for syphilis — but found French and Portuguese fishermen harvesting numerous fish along the Great Banks, an area 350 miles of coast south of Newfoundland. There, the cold Labrador Current and the Gulf Stream joined, creating ideal conditions for a variety of fish. Gosnold named the land, which jutted out to sea, Cape Cod.

New England’s Major Groundfish, Except Cod, Enter into MSC Assessment

July 7, 2017 — SEAFOOD NEWS — New England has often been vilified as having some of the worst overfished species in US waters and has long had a contentious fight over fisheries management.

However, three stocks in New England are fully healthy:  haddock, Pollock and redfish. Together the annual catch limit for these stocks totals more than 70,000 tons.  Such a success in rebuilding fisheries is often lost in the attention paid to the failure of the Georges Bank and Gulf of Maine cod stocks to recover.

Now a client group led by Atlantic Trawlers of Maine, which is owned by Jim Odlin, and Fishermen’s Wharf in Gloucester, led by Vito Giacalone, have completed the MSC pre-assessment indicating that the fisheries will be able to meet the criteria, and have started the full assessment process.

The certification is being done by Acoura of Scotland, and the individuals who will carry out the assessment are Dr. Joseph DeAlteris, who recently retired from the University of Rhode Island and has many years of both Certification body and stock assessment experience in New England.

The other reviewer is Dick Allen. Allen has 45 years of experience as a commercial fishermen in New England, a Masters in Marine Affairs, and has been intimately involved in New England fishery management for decades.

The assessment is on a timeline to be completed by December of 2017.

The MSC certification will help expand the supermarket redfish programs, as well as support more sales of haddock and Pollock.

Currently, the harvests in these healthy fisheries are constrained by choke species, including cod.

For example, only around 9% of the Georges Bank Haddock Allowable Catch 51,000 tons was caught in 2016, while the Gulf of Maine haddock with an ACL of 2400 tons saw a catch rate of around 66%.

For redfish, the ACL in 2016 was 9500 tons, with a 43% harvest rate, and Pollock was 17,700 tons, with a 16.7% harvest rate.

The MSC certification is a step forward in further utilizing these fisheries, enhancing their markets, and explaining to customers that some New England and Gulf of Maine stocks are healthy and managed to global standards.

Jim Odlin says that the certification will be available to all companies who wish to contribute equitably to the costs of acquiring and maintaining the certificate, as per MSC policy.

Changes to cod, haddock, flounder quotas eyed in New England

July 3, 2017 — Federal fishing regulators are planning a host of changes to the quota limits of several important New England fish, including cod.

New England fishermen search for cod in two key fishing areas, Georges Bank and the Gulf of Maine. Regulators have enacted a series of cutbacks to the cod quota in those areas in recent years as cod stocks have dwindled.

This year, regulators want to trim the Georges Bank cod quota by 13 percent and keep Gulf of Maine’s quota the same. They also want to keep the Georges Bank haddock quota about the same and enact a 25 percent increase for the Gulf of Maine haddock quota. Changes are also planned for some flounder species.
